Business Objects Previews New Information OnDemand Solution

Groundbreaking Solution to Make Third-Party Financial and Market Data Available Within BI Solutions via Software as a Service Model

BERLIN - (BUSINESS WIRE) - Business Objects (Nasdaq:BOBJ) (Euronext Paris ISIN code: FR0004026250 - BOB), the worlds leading provider of business intelligence (BI) solutions, previewed a new Information OnDemand offering today at its European User Conference in Berlin, Germany. This landmark solution makes external market information available to customers in BI-ready format, directly from within their business intelligence solution. This announcement continues the companys momentum in the on demand BI market, where the company has established itself as the clear leader, with nearly 45,000 on demand subscribers.

For the first time, relevant external commercial data will be available in a familiar, easy to use BI format that is instantly ready to be analyzed, understood, and acted upon. The solution is expected to initially include financial and market data, available in pre-built analytics including Crystal reports and Crystal Xcelsius dashboards. Over time, the data available is planned to expand into dozens of other sources including industry data, such as retail and manufacturing information. Customers will be able to find and purchase the offerings from an online store, and then immediately make use of pre-built analytics and incorporate them into their existing BI system. The Business Objects Information OnDemand offering will enable customers to gain a more holistic view of their business and lead to more informed business decisions.

Todays business managers require more than just their own company data to make insightful decisions, said Steve Lucas, vice president of the on demand business at Business Objects. Companies need to leverage accurate and up-to-date external data to quickly perform market research, sales planning, financial, and competitive analyses. However, manually collecting, cutting, and pasting that data for analysis is time-consuming, tedious, and error-prone. Our new solution will revolutionize the way companies use external financial and market data in their reports and dashboards, by putting relevant third party information directly at their fingertips. Our customers will have the external information they need, in the format they want, just a click away.

The Business Objects Information OnDemand offering will enable customers to quickly identify and purchase only the information that is relevant and important to them, without having to sign up for a full data service. Much the same way the iTunes® Store allows iTunes users to purchase an individual song from within a full album, the Information OnDemand solution will allow Business Objects customers to purchase individual reports and analytics pre-populated with content from the available data providers. This information will be delivered in a format that is already configured for use as stand alone views and within their Business Objects solution saving significant time and effort, and reducing user entry errors that often occur with traditional methods of including external data sources in BI analyses.

For example, a business manager trying to create a benchmark comparison of company performance with key competitors would typically have to gather information from SEC filings and multiple other sources, compile the data into a spreadsheet, and then load the information into their business intelligence system. With Information OnDemand, the business manager will be able to simply access the Business Objects Information OnDemand store and select the required market data. Since it is pre-formatted for easy use, the data will be ready to view or use in their reports and dashboards for comparison.

This new solution will also open up new opportunities for Business Objects partners. Business Objects Solution Provider Partners will be able to utilize the Business Objects OnDemand infrastructure to access the available external data sources and create their own specialized BI content for resale from the Business Objects store.

Availability

Business Objects plans to deliver a beta version of this new offering by the end of this quarter, and general availability is expected in Q3 of 2007.
